  1. 4 days ago · So far, three Indian films have made it to the final nominations: Mother India (1957), Salaam Bombay (1988), Lagaan (2001). Last year, the Malayalam film 2018: Everyone is a Hero was India's official entry. The film is based on the Kerala floods that caused massive destruction in the state that year.

  2. 7 hours ago · Mira Nair scripted history as the first female filmmaker to have her film officially submitted as India’s entry to the Oscars. Her groundbreaking film Salaam Bombay not only represented India but also made a significant impact on global cinema, reaching the top five in the Best Foreign Film category at the 61st Academy Awards.
